// Fixture: parity matrix for the Skylark JS and Kotlin SDKs.
// Plugin authors: this fixture asserts that both clients expose
// identical method signatures for stream subscription, retry
// configuration, and pagination cursors. If you add a capability
// to one SDK, extend this matrix so parity drift is caught in CI
// rather than by downstream plugins. The fixture replays recorded
// responses from the Skylark mock gateway; live calls are never
// made. Requests against the mock gateway authenticate with the
// token that follows.

portal login ticket: eyJhbGciOiJIUzI1NiIsInR5cCI6IkpXVCJ9.eyJzdWIiOiIwEOsktwVNwIn0.-UJU3fdyyCgG

Ticket: FlagForge rollout framework rejecting third-party plugin registrations in the Westbrook sandbox. Root cause: the sandbox .env shipped with the evaluation endpoint pointed at the retired v1 gateway, so plugin handshakes fail with a stale-schema error. Plugin authors: update FLAGFORGE_ENDPOINT to the v2 gateway, confirm your plugin manifest declares schema 2, and retest registration. Once the endpoint line is corrected, the registration secret must be added on the line immediately after it.

sealed setting: VAULT_KEY20=c8ea1e419912889df6b4

## Ticket #4417: Vault Locked During Autocomplete Index Rebuild

While investigating slow autocomplete queries on the Quillfeather search cluster, the index rebuild job exceeded its lease and the credentials vault auto-locked. As a new contractor, do not force-unlock; instead, pause the rebuild, confirm the suggestion shards are read-only, and document current latency figures. To reopen the vault and resume indexing, use the recovery passphrase provided on the line below.

unlock words, kawig-bawef: belax-sorir-druax-ulaiel-wenael-belael